# I V X L C
ROMANS = [None] * 100
ROMANS_COUNTER = [None] * 100
def roman_counter(symbol: str) -> tuple:
return tuple(symbol.count(char) for char in ("I", "V", "X", "L", "C"))
def roman_convertor(num: int) -> str:
# fmt: off
return ("", "X", "XX", "XXX", "XL", "L", "LX", "LXX", "LXXX", "XC")[num // 10] \
+ ("", "I", "II", "III", "IV", "V", "VI", "VII", "VIII", "IX")[num % 10]
# fmt: on
if __name__ == "__main__":
roman = input()
for i in range(100):
temp = roman_convertor(i)
ROMANS[i] = temp
ROMANS_COUNTER[i] = roman_counter(temp)
count = roman_counter(roman)
for i in range(100):
if ROMANS_COUNTER[i] == count:
print(ROMANS[i])
break
